Output f32095818955b78a7d70661a7c0a687a92a12813bca4369bbf7dc36aa8bc07a0:1

value
34384115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8593d858ea050e1a397e3b7c85d5b385aa2908e6 OP_EQUAL
address
3DsJuWqjSyyRTvGsDwGkB4LHrKa5L325bV
transaction
f32095818955b78a7d70661a7c0a687a92a12813bca4369bbf7dc36aa8bc07a0
spent
true